Since 2017, Ministry of Defence Police has appeared as a respondent in 7 employment tribunal cases, with £0 in total awards recorded against the employer.
| # | Claim type | Cases |
|---|---|---|
| 01 | Disability discrimination | 4 |
| 02 | Sex discrimination | 2 |
| 03 | Unfair dismissal | 1 |
| 04 | Race discrimination | 1 |
